Starting in 2019, to protect cultural and natural resources from overuse, Haena State Park is now subject to daily visitor limits and requires advanced paid reservations to enter the park, as well as for parking inside the park. The park also cares for endangered species, some of which exist nowhere else. 1) For State Parks, campsites or cabins may be reserved up to one year in advance, with the exception of KÄ«holo State Park Reserve on Hawai'i Island and all parks on O'ahu, which can be reserved up to 30 days in advance, and NÄpali Coast State Wilderness Park camping, which can be reserved up to 90 days in advance.
